1 Kings 11:3-5
1599 Geneva Bible
3 And he had seven hundred wives, that were [a]princesses, and three hundred [b]concubines, and his wives turned away his heart.
4 For when Solomon was old, his wives turned his heart after other gods, so that his heart was not [c]perfect with the Lord his God as was the heart of David his father.
5 For Solomon followed (A)Ashtoreth the god of the Sidonians, and [d]Milcom the abomination of the Ammonites.

1 Kings 11:3-5
New International Version
3 He had seven hundred wives of royal birth and three hundred concubines,(A) and his wives led him astray.(B) 4 As Solomon grew old, his wives turned his heart after other gods,(C) and his heart was not fully devoted(D) to the Lord his God, as the heart of David his father had been. 5 He followed Ashtoreth(E) the goddess of the Sidonians, and Molek(F) the detestable god of the Ammonites.
